Orientation | Mean of orientation in English Dictionary
/ˌorijənˈteɪʃən/
- Noun
- a person's feelings, interests, and beliefs
- his political/religious/spiritual orientation
- a main interest, quality, or goal
- The organization has a decidedly conservative orientation.
- Her later works were more introspective in orientation.
- the process of giving people training and information about a new job, situation, etc.
- These materials are used for the orientation of new employees.
- an orientation meeting/session
- The weekend before the semester begins is the freshman orientation period. [=the time when new students start to become familiar with a college]
- New students need to go through a short orientation before they begin classes.
- the position or direction of something
- They had to adjust the antenna's orientation in order to receive a clear signal.
- The valley has a north-south orientation. [=the valley runs from north to south]
